The new CBA now lifts the ban on cannabis, enabling players to use the substance for medical and personal use. This momentous decision not only acknowledges the shifting public perception of cannabis but also opens the door for player investments in the booming cannabis industry.</p> <h2><strong>Navigating the New Landscape: NBA’s Revised Cannabis Policy</strong></h2> <p>The NBA and the National Basketball Players Association (NBPA) have joined forces, endorsing a progressive seven-year contract that revolutionizes the NBA Cannabis <a href="https://blackcannabismagazine.com/nba-embraces-cannabis-new-cba-removes-marijuana-from-drug-testing-system/">Policy</a>. In this new regime, marijuana is no longer a prohibited substance. Moreover, it opens up opportunities for players to invest in cannabis companies under certain terms and conditions.</p> <h2><strong>Player Investments and Endorsements in the Cannabis Industry</strong></h2> <p>Under this evolved <a href="https://nbpa.com/cba">Collective Bargaining Agreement</a>, players can engage in passive investments in cannabis companies, provided their share doesn’t exceed 50% of the business. There’s also room for players to own stakes, direct or indirect, in companies that produce or sell CBD products.</p> <p>The changes also spill over into endorsement deals. While players can endorse or promote CBD products, written approval is necessary from both the NBA and the Players Association.</p> <h2><strong>Balancing Freedom and Accountability: The Continued Regulations</strong></h2> <p>Despite the revolutionary changes, the NBA continues to uphold certain regulations in relation to substance use. The agreement details the repercussions for players who do not adhere to prescribed alcohol or marijuana treatment programs. If players show disregard for their responsibilities or test positive for marijuana and/or alcohol, they might face disciplinary action.</p> <h2><strong>Implications of the Policy Change: The Broader Sports Landscape</strong></h2> <p>The amendment to the CBA marks a significant shift in professional sports’ attitude towards cannabis. This change is already reflected in the actions of players like NBA superstar Kevin Durant, who partnered with Weedmaps, an online marijuana marketplace, to help destigmatize cannabis use.</p> <p>However, there are still challenges. Players interested in investing in the cannabis industry must be cautious. The NBA Cannabis Policy might have changed, but the federal prohibition and varying state-level legislations mean legal, regulatory, and reputational risks persist.</p> <p>In conclusion, this modification to the CBA is a crucial step forward in redefining the relationship between professional sports and cannabis. As the legalization tide turns and societal attitudes continue to shift, the NBA’s stance has the potential to significantly influence not only the league and its players but also the entire sports world.</p> <p>The post <a href="https://blackcannabismagazine.com/nba-lifts-ban-on-cannabis-and-allows-players-to-invest/">NBA Lifts Ban on Cannabis and Allows Players to Invest</a> appeared first on <a href="https://blackcannabismagazine.com">Black Cannabis Magazine</a>.</p> ]]></content:encoded> <wfw:commentRss>https://blackcannabismagazine.com/nba-lifts-ban-on-cannabis-and-allows-players-to-invest/feed/</wfw:commentRss> <slash:comments>0</slash:comments> <post-id xmlns="com-wordpress:feed-additions:1">197910</post-id> </item> <item> <title>NBA Embraces Cannabis: New CBA Removes Marijuana from Drug Testing System</title> <link>https://blackcannabismagazine.com/nba-embraces-cannabis-new-cba-removes-marijuana-from-drug-testing-system/</link> <comments>https://blackcannabismagazine.com/nba-embraces-cannabis-new-cba-removes-marijuana-from-drug-testing-system/?noamp=mobile#respond</comments> <dc:creator><![CDATA[Hazey Taughtme]]></dc:creator> <pubDate>Sat, 01 Apr 2023 15:15:15 +0000</pubDate> <category><![CDATA[NEWS]]></category> <category><![CDATA[Sports]]></category> <category><![CDATA[cannabis policy]]></category> <category><![CDATA[collective bargaining agreement]]></category> <category><![CDATA[drug testing]]></category> <category><![CDATA[featured]]></category> <category><![CDATA[Kevin Durant]]></category> <category><![CDATA[marijuana]]></category> <category><![CDATA[NBA]]></category> <category><![CDATA[progressive stance]]></category> <guid isPermaLink="false">https://blackcannabismagazine.com/?p=196622</guid> <description><![CDATA[<p>NBA Players Score Big with Cannabis Investment and Policy Changes In a historic collective bargaining agreement between the NBA and its players association, players are set to benefit from two groundbreaking changes related to cannabis. Firstly, the deal allows players to invest in and promote cannabis companies. Secondly, marijuana will be removed from the league’s drug testing program. These changes, pending ratification by the union and team governors, mark a significant shift in the NBA’s approach to cannabis.</p> <p><strong>Cannabis Off the Drug Testing Program</strong></p> <p>The tentative agreement would remove marijuana from the league’s drug testing program, as reported by The Athletic sports media site. This move follows a growing trend of acceptance and legalization of marijuana for medicinal and recreational purposes across the United States. NBA stars, like Kevin Durant, have been outspoken advocates for cannabis use, aiming to change the narrative around marijuana.</p> <p><strong>A Win for the Cannabis Industry</strong></p> <p>This tentative agreement provides a significant endorsement for the cannabis industry and opens up a new source of funding for marijuana companies, which have faced challenges in a tight funding market. The seven-year agreement would mark a turning point for the NBA, which has previously penalized players for marijuana consumption and barred them from participating in cannabis sponsorships or business ventures.</p> <p><strong>Investing in NBA and WNBA Teams</strong></p> <p>In addition to the new cannabis policy, the proposed labor agreement would permit players to invest in NBA and WNBA teams. This move would further solidify the relationship between players and the league, allowing them to benefit from their association with professional basketball.</p> <p><strong>Previous Stance on Cannabis</strong></p> <p>Historically, the NBA has maintained a strict stance on marijuana use. Players faced testing, fines, and suspensions if found to have used the substance. However, as more states have legalized cannabis and attitudes have evolved, the league’s policy had become increasingly outdated.</p> <p><strong>Kevin Durant: Changing the Narrative</strong><strong><br /> </strong></p> <p>Phoenix Suns’ Kevin Durant has been an outspoken advocate for cannabis use. In a David Letterman interview last year, he revealed that he started using marijuana at 22. Durant compared its effects to having a glass of wine, as it clears distractions from the brain. He also expressed his desire to “change the narrative” surrounding marijuana, citing the injustice of people serving lengthy jail sentences for selling the substance.</p> <p><iframe loading="lazy" title="My Next Guest Needs No Introduction with David Letterman | Kevin Durant Talks Weed" width="740" height="416" src="https://www.youtube.com/embed/uq8AhCOuERQ?feature=oembed" frameborder="0" allow="accelerometer; autoplay; clipboard-write; encrypted-media; gyroscope; picture-in-picture; web-share" allowfullscreen></iframe></p> <p><strong>Other Changes in the CBA</strong></p> <p>The collective bargaining agreement also includes other significant changes, such as an in-season tournament, long desired by Commissioner Adam Silver, and a requirement for players to appear in at least 65 games to be eligible for top individual awards, such as Most Valuable Player. A second luxury tax level has been introduced, affecting the way teams can use their midlevel exception to sign players.</p> <p><strong>Looking Ahead</strong></p> <p>The NBA’s progressive step in removing marijuana from its drug testing system is a welcome change that reflects the evolving attitudes towards cannabis in society. This new location will complement his already successful cannabis store in Belltown, offering a diverse range of products in a Seattle-themed, 3,500-square-foot showroom.</p> <blockquote class="instagram-media" style="background: #FFF; border: 0; border-radius: 3px; box-shadow: 0 0 1px 0 rgba(0,0,0,0.5),0 1px 10px 0 rgba(0,0,0,0.15); margin: 1px; max-width: 540px; min-width: 326px; padding: 0; width: calc(100% - 2px);" data-instgrm-permalink="https://www.instagram.com/reel/CoiNlagD1i8/?utm_source=ig_embed&utm_campaign=loading" data-instgrm-version="14"> <div style="padding: 16px;"> <p> </p> <div style="display: flex; flex-direction: row; align-items: center;"> <div style="background-color: #f4f4f4; border-radius: 50%; flex-grow: 0; height: 40px; margin-right: 14px; width: 40px;"></div> <div style="display: flex; flex-direction: column; flex-grow: 1; justify-content: center;"> <div style="background-color: #f4f4f4; border-radius: 4px; flex-grow: 0; height: 14px; margin-bottom: 6px; width: 100px;"></div> <div style="background-color: #f4f4f4; border-radius: 4px; flex-grow: 0; height: 14px; width: 60px;"></div> </div> </div> <div style="padding: 19% 0;"></div> <div style="display: block; height: 50px; margin: 0 auto 12px; width: 50px;"></div> <div style="padding-top: 8px;"> <div style="color: #3897f0; font-family: Arial,sans-serif; font-size: 14px; font-style: normal; font-weight: 550; line-height: 18px;">View this post on Instagram</div> </div> <div style="padding: 12.5% 0;"></div> <div style="display: flex; flex-direction: row; margin-bottom: 14px; align-items: center;"> <div> <div style="background-color: #f4f4f4; border-radius: 50%; height: 12.5px; width: 12.5px; transform: translateX(0px) translateY(7px);"></div> <div style="background-color: #f4f4f4; height: 12.5px; transform: rotate(-45deg) translateX(3px) translateY(1px); width: 12.5px; flex-grow: 0; margin-right: 14px; margin-left: 2px;"></div> <div style="background-color: #f4f4f4; border-radius: 50%; height: 12.5px; width: 12.5px; transform: translateX(9px) translateY(-18px);"></div> </div> <div style="margin-left: 8px;"> <div style="background-color: #f4f4f4; border-radius: 50%; flex-grow: 0; height: 20px; width: 20px;"></div> <div style="width: 0; height: 0; border-top: 2px solid transparent; border-left: 6px solid #f4f4f4; border-bottom: 2px solid transparent; transform: translateX(16px) translateY(-4px) rotate(30deg);"></div> </div> <div style="margin-left: auto;"> <div style="width: 0px; border-top: 8px solid #F4F4F4; border-right: 8px solid transparent; transform: translateY(16px);"></div> <div style="background-color: #f4f4f4; flex-grow: 0; height: 12px; width: 16px; transform: translateY(-4px);"></div> <div style="width: 0; height: 0; border-top: 8px solid #F4F4F4; border-left: 8px solid transparent; transform: translateY(-4px) translateX(8px);"></div> </div> </div> <div style="display: flex; flex-direction: column; flex-grow: 1; justify-content: center; margin-bottom: 24px;"> <div style="background-color: #f4f4f4; border-radius: 4px; flex-grow: 0; height: 14px; margin-bottom: 6px; width: 224px;"></div> <div style="background-color: #f4f4f4; border-radius: 4px; flex-grow: 0; height: 14px; width: 144px;"></div> </div> <p> </p> <p style="color: #c9c8cd; font-family: Arial,sans-serif; font-size: 14px; line-height: 17px; margin-bottom: 0; margin-top: 8px; overflow: hidden; padding: 8px 0 7px; text-align: center; text-overflow: ellipsis; white-space: nowrap;"><a style="color: #c9c8cd; font-family: Arial,sans-serif; font-size: 14px; font-style: normal; font-weight: normal; line-height: 17px; text-decoration: none;" href="https://www.instagram.com/reel/CoiNlagD1i8/?utm_source=ig_embed&utm_campaign=loading" target="_blank" rel="noopener">A post shared by Black Cannabis Magazine® (@blackcannabismagazine)</a></p> </div> </blockquote> <p><script async src="//www.instagram.com/embed.js"></script></p> <h5>Dedicated to Diversity</h5> <p>The new dispensary, co-owned by Shawn Kemp and Tran Du, is committed to promoting diversity within the staff and promoting from within. Du, who started as a budtender, has worked his way up the ranks to become Kemp’s business partner and general manager. With Kemp now one of the few Black owners in the state of Washington, the new dispensary aims to be a boost for the reputation of the business and for people of color fighting for representation in the industry.</p> <h5>A Showcase of Seattle Culture</h5> <p>The former bank building, now home to Shawn Kemp’s dispensary, features a massive mural of Kemp, former Sonic teammate Gary Payton, Bruce Lee, and Jimi Hendrix, showcasing Seattle’s rich cultural history. The dispensary will offer over 3,000 unique products, making it the best selection in the city.</p> <h5>Celebrating the Grand Opening</h5> <p>Shawn Kemp and friends will host a ribbon cutting event on Saturday, Feb. 11 at noon, celebrating the grand opening of the new dispensary. With special 50% off sales and the possibility of celebrity appearances, the event promises to be a celebration for fans and customers alike. The dispensary is located at 2764 First Avenue South, near Starbucks Center.</p> <h5>Past Missteps Highlight Lack of Diversity</h5> <p>The opening of Shawn Kemp’s first cannabis store in Seattle on Oct. 30, 2020, drew attention to the lack of diversity in the city’s cannabis market. A mistaken news release promoting the store as Seattle’s first Black-owned marijuana retailer led to conflicting news reports and complaints from industry officials. Despite the confusion, Kemp’s name has since been added to the license, making him one of the first people in Seattle to identify as Black or African-American among retail store owners.</p> <h5>Committed to Social Equity</h5> <p>Paula Sardinas, a lobbyist for Washington state’s Commission on African American Affairs, pointed out that the attention received by Shawn Kemp’s cannabis store is further proof that more efforts are needed to achieve social equity in the state’s cannabis industry. The company is committed to lowering barriers to access and promoting diversity in the industry.</p> <p>The post <a href="https://blackcannabismagazine.com/shawn-kemp-expands-cannabis-ventures-with-new-dispensary-in-seattle/">Shawn Kemp Expands Cannabis Ventures with New Dispensary in Seattle</a> appeared first on <a href="https://blackcannabismagazine.com">Black Cannabis Magazine</a>.</p> ]]></content:encoded> <wfw:commentRss>https://blackcannabismagazine.com/shawn-kemp-expands-cannabis-ventures-with-new-dispensary-in-seattle/feed/</wfw:commentRss> <slash:comments>0</slash:comments> <post-id xmlns="com-wordpress:feed-additions:1">187547</post-id> </item> <item> <title>NBA Hall of Famer Ben Wallace & Michigan-Based Rair Launch Undrafted®, An Exclusive Cannabis Product Line</title> <link>https://blackcannabismagazine.com/nba-hall-of-famer-ben-wallace-michigan-based-rair-launch-undrafted-an-exclusive-cannabis-product-line/</link> <comments>https://blackcannabismagazine.com/nba-hall-of-famer-ben-wallace-michigan-based-rair-launch-undrafted-an-exclusive-cannabis-product-line/?noamp=mobile#respond</comments> <dc:creator><![CDATA[Press Releases]]></dc:creator> <pubDate>Tue, 22 Mar 2022 16:00:16 +0000</pubDate> <category><![CDATA[Press Releases]]></category> <category><![CDATA[Ben Wallace]]></category> <category><![CDATA[NBA]]></category> <category><![CDATA[Rair]]></category> <category><![CDATA[Undrafted]]></category> <guid isPermaLink="false">https://blackcannabismagazine.com/?p=143222</guid> <description><![CDATA[<p>  (DETROIT – March 22, 2022)—Ben Wallace, NBA Hall of Fame player and Detroit Pistons’ legend, officially unveiled Undrafted®—a new brand of cannabis products, strain and merchandise with Jackson-based Rair.
